Five people were injured in a shooting Sunday afternoon on Indy's far east side.
On Monday, July 28, an IMPD spokesperson confirmed the victims are between the ages of 10 and 19 years old and said, "the investigation remains ongoing."
According to IMPD, around 4:15 p.m. July 27, officers were called to the 3900 block of Hornickel Drive, near East 38th Street and North German Church Road, on a report of a person shot. When officers arrived, they found one person suffering from a gunshot wound. They were reported to be "awake and breathing."
